Chemical Property Profile of 2-amino-5-oxo-4-(thiophen-2-yl)-5,6,7,8-tetrahydro-4H-chromene-3-carbothioamide
Property Insights of 2-amino-5-oxo-4-(thiophen-2-yl)-5,6,7,8-tetrahydro-4H-chromene-3-carbothioamide
The XLogP value of 2.3254 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 2-amino-5-oxo-4-(thiophen-2-yl)-5,6,7,8-tetrahydro-4H-chromene-3-carbothioamide. The TPSA of 78.34 Ų falls within the moderate polarity range, balancing permeability and solubility for 2-amino-5-oxo-4-(thiophen-2-yl)-5,6,7,8-tetrahydro-4H-chromene-3-carbothioamide. Following Lipinski's Rule of Five, 2-amino-5-oxo-4-(thiophen-2-yl)-5,6,7,8-tetrahydro-4H-chromene-3-carbothioamide has 2 hydrogen bond donor(s) and 5 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
